Quoted in Family Matters: Warding Off Potential Wedding Day Disasters

As a consultant, I have to find out what my clients' priorities are. In the extreme case of a mother trying to design her daughter's wedding, I try to get a balance of the two. I urge brides to think about their battles. Don't look back on a decision that was made; once it's done it's done. You've got to concentrate on what the wedding day is about. You can't keep worrying that your mom wanted ecru paper for the invitations and you wanted white.

Quoted in Getting Married Away

Sacramento has so many lovely places, says wedding planner Lora Ward, owner of A Day to Remember in downtown Sacramento. One of Ward's favorite areas with a destination feel is the Sierra Nevada foothills - known in these parts as Gold Country - in particular, Auburn, Nevada and Grass Valley, because of the towns' ties to early state and local history. Ward recomends Empire Mine State Historical Park in Grass Valley
